IEC 60384-15:2017 applies to through-hole/leaded polar and bipolar tantalum electrolyte capacitors with solid and non‑solid electrolyte for use in electronic equipment. It includes capacitors for long‑life applications and capacitors for general‑purpose applications. This document prescribes preferred ratings and characteristics and to select from IEC 60384‑1:2016 the appropriate quality assessment procedures, tests and measuring methods and to give general performance requirements for this type of capacitor. This edition includes the following significant technical changes with respect to the previous edition: a) Revision of the structure in accordance with ISO/IEC Directives, Part 2:2016 (seventh edition) to the extent practicable, and harmonization between other similar kinds of documents. b) In addition, Clause 4 and all the tables have been reviewed in order to prevent duplications and contradictions.

Overview
IEC 60384-15:2017 is the sectional specification in the IEC 60384 series that defines requirements for fixed tantalum capacitors (through‑hole/leaded) using solid or non‑solid electrolyte. It applies to both polar and bipolar tantalum electrolyte capacitors intended for electronic equipment, covering general‑purpose and long‑life application classes. The document prescribes preferred ratings and characteristics and references IEC 60384‑1:2016 for selecting the appropriate quality‑assessment procedures, tests and measuring methods.
This edition (2017) revises the structure to align with ISO/IEC Directives, Part 2 and updates Clause 4 and the tables to remove duplications and contradictions.
Key Topics
- Scope and definitions for tantalum fixed capacitors (solid/non‑solid electrolyte, leaded/through‑hole, polar/bipolar).
- Preferred ratings and characteristics: nominal capacitance, tolerances, rated voltage, category voltage, surge and reverse voltages, rated temperature.
- Quality assessment procedures: primary manufacture checks, qualification approval, conformance inspection and sampling plans.
- Comprehensive test and measurement procedures, including:
- Leakage current, capacitance and dissipation factor (tan δ)
- Impedance and insulation resistance
- Robustness of terminations, solderability and resistance to soldering heat
- Environmental and mechanical tests: rapid temperature change, vibration, shock, bump
- Climatic sequence, damp heat (steady state and cyclic), endurance and surge voltage tests
- Reverse voltage, charge/discharge behavior and solvent/marking resistance
- Marking, packaging and information required for detail specifications and product identification.
